Stoke Gifford is in the northern suburbs of Bristol. It's home to Bristol Parkway station, close to the University of the West of England, MOD and other major employers. It neighbours Bradley Stoke, Harry Stoke, Cheswick Village. Filton is nearby on the Gloucester Road, which takes you south towards the city.

The area has excellent travel links. Bristol Parkway station has mainline and local trains. There’s a metro bus service, and bus and cycle lanes. The M32 is moments away and the Almondsbury Interchange linking the M5 and M4 can be joined via the A38.

Local homes

The area expanded hugely in the 1980s. What were then just small villages, now offering wonderful cottages, grew into large housing estates, merging with Bradley Stoke to the north.

The majority of property is modern build, ranging from starter homes to large detached houses with garages and driveways. New builds are still available.

Local places

Shopping: There are local convenience shops, a large supermarket on Fox Den Road, and Willow Brook Shopping Centre at Bradley Stoke. For more national chains, there is a large retail park nearby at Filton Abbey Wood.

Eating and drinking: The Beaufort Arms, The Fox Den, Bayleaf, as well as national chains at Filton Abbey Wood, Willow Brook Shopping Centre and Cribbs Causeway

Schools: St Mary’s Catholic Primary School, Little Stoke Primary School, St Michael's CofE Primary School, Bailey’s Court Primary School, Abbeywood Community School
